The market is seeing rapid growth as more men use jewellery as a form of self expression... and as part of the wider shift to formal wear this season, we have noticed a growing demand specifically for accessories to style suits. With a surge in antique tie pins, rare lapel pins, Diamond cufflinks and Signed watches, we have noticed it is men who are currently paving the way for the brooch revival.
Noticeable across glamorous red carpet events, we have seen the likes of Actor Paul Mescal wearing a vintage Cartier pin, Michael B Jordan in Tiffany bird brooches, in addition to John Krasinski and Barry Keogan, both seen wearing Diamond brooches. With many of these male celebrities experimenting with jewels, it seems many men are searching for colourful pieces to pin to their lapels when accessorising for special occasions.
